| Description of Services: | Inpatient transitional program for frail seniors whose goals are to improve functional abilities, enhance their health and wellness and prolong their independent living in the community | ||
|
|
|||
| Fees: | Covered by OHIP | ||
| Eligibility - Population(s) Served: | Frail Seniors 65+ with an established discharge destination in the community who have impaired pre-morbid functioning with recent acute decline/deconditioning, but not bedbound. Medically stable (not requiring acute intervention/monitoring) and have the ability to tolerate a minimum of 30- 60 minutes of therapy per day 3-5 days per week. Patients with sufficient cognitive ability and motivation to participate in therapy. | ||
| Application: | Medical Referral Required | ||
